The Architect - Observability & Monitoring Solutions is responsible for designing, implementing, and maintaining enterprise-level monitoring and observability platforms to ensure system reliability, performance, and operational excellence. This role drives innovation through automation and AI-based solutions, collaborates across teams, and serves as a subject matter expert for monitoring tools and processes.
Primary Responsibilities:
  • Platform Management & Optimization
    • Lead administration and lifecycle management of Grafana Enterprise, including onboarding, upgrades, and troubleshooting
    • Develop and maintain dashboards for system health and performance monitoring
    • Support Dynatrace adoption and enhance dashboarding capabilities for cloud observability
  • Configuration & Integration
    • Create and update Telegraf configuration files for vendor partners
    • Migrate dashboards from legacy platforms to next-generation environments
    • Resolve event ingestion and integration issues across monitoring tools
  • Operational Excellence
    • Ensure platform stability, availability, and compliance through proactive vulnerability management and lifecycle maintenance
    • Drive process improvements for monitoring workflows and incident management
  • Innovation & AI Enablement
    • Explore and implement AI-driven solutions for observability and automation
    • Share knowledge and best practices through internal guides and community contributions (e.g., AI reference materials, Copilot usage)
  • Collaboration & Leadership
    • Partner with cross-functional teams (Telemetry, OptumServe, VOC, OptumRX) to align monitoring strategies with business needs
    • Act as a subject matter expert (SME) in ITSM discussions and change management processes

Required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field (or equivalent experience)
  • Proven experience with monitoring tools such as Grafana Enterprise, Dynatrace, and Telegraf
  • Solid knowledge of observability best practices and ITSM processes
  • Familiarity with AI-based automation and productivity tools (e.g., M365 Copilot)
  • Proven excellent problem-solving, communication, and collaboration skills

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Experience in cloud environments and infrastructure monitoring
  • Experience in enterprise-scale technology environments
  • Knowledge of scripting and automation frameworks
